Kapanlagi.com - Oregairu or Yahari Ore no Seishun Love Comedy wa Machigatteiru is a teenage romance anime that focuses on emotional conflicts, sarcastic dialogues, and characters with inner wounds. The story follows Hachiman Hikigaya, a super cynical high school student who is part of the Service Club along with Yukino Yukinoshita and Yui Yuigahama.

Through various student issues, this anime dissects themes of loneliness, social pretenses, and the search for identity in a realistic and sometimes painful way. The plot of Oregairu is slow but deep, relying more on conversations, expressions, and inner conflicts than on over-the-top drama.

If you enjoy that kind of vibe, here are 5 anime that are similar to Oregairu and are guaranteed to make you think while also tugging at your heartstrings.

1. Hyouka

Hyouka follows Oreki Houtarou, a lazy high school student who prefers to live an energy-saving life. His life changes when he joins the classical literature club and gets involved in various small daily mysteries.

Similarity to Oregairu: Both have a cold, smart, and cynical male protagonist, and the story unfolds through dialogue and social observation, rather than big action.

2. Rascal Does Not Dream of Bunny Girl Senpai

Sakuta Azusagawa meets Mai Sakurajima, a high school actress who suddenly 'disappears' from the sight of others. This phenomenon is called puberty syndrome, a metaphor for the psychological issues of teenagers.

Similarity to Oregairu: The dialogue is sharp, full of sarcasm, and focuses on emotional issues and human relationships with a mature approach.

3. Classroom of the Elite

Ayanokoji Kiyotaka enters an elite school with an extreme competition system. Behind his flat demeanor, he harbors manipulative intelligence.

Similarity to Oregairu: The protagonist is also anti-mainstream, introverted, and willing to 'be the bad guy' for the best outcome, similar to how Hachiman solves problems.

4. Just Because!

This anime follows the lives of high school students approaching graduation, as old feelings resurface and relationships begin to change.

Similarity to Oregairu: Realistic drama, slow but impactful romance, and a focus on the typical emotional confusion of teenagers without excessive drama.

5. Tsuki ga Kirei

A simple love story between two awkward middle school students, conveyed more through small gestures and text messages.

Similarity to Oregairu: Both feature realistic romance, minimal clichés, and subtle emotional depth, suitable for viewers who enjoy calm yet profound stories.
